Searched refs:msm_fence_context (Results 1 – 5 of 5) sorted by relevance
/Linux-v5.4/drivers/gpu/drm/msm/ |
D | msm_fence.h | 12 struct msm_fence_context { struct 23 struct msm_fence_context * msm_fence_context_alloc(struct drm_device *dev, argument 25 void msm_fence_context_free(struct msm_fence_context *fctx); 27 int msm_wait_fence(struct msm_fence_context *fctx, uint32_t fence, 29 void msm_update_fence(struct msm_fence_context *fctx, uint32_t fence); 31 struct dma_fence * msm_fence_alloc(struct msm_fence_context *fctx);
|
D | msm_fence.c | 13 struct msm_fence_context * 16 struct msm_fence_context *fctx; in msm_fence_context_alloc() 31 void msm_fence_context_free(struct msm_fence_context *fctx) in msm_fence_context_free() 36 static inline bool fence_completed(struct msm_fence_context *fctx, uint32_t fence) in fence_completed() 42 int msm_wait_fence(struct msm_fence_context *fctx, uint32_t fence, in msm_wait_fence() 81 void msm_update_fence(struct msm_fence_context *fctx, uint32_t fence) in msm_update_fence() 92 struct msm_fence_context *fctx; 124 msm_fence_alloc(struct msm_fence_context *fctx) in msm_fence_alloc()
|
D | msm_ringbuffer.h | 47 struct msm_fence_context *fctx;
|
D | msm_drv.h | 43 struct msm_fence_context; 301 struct msm_fence_context *fctx, bool exclusive);
|
D | msm_gem.c | 703 struct msm_fence_context *fctx, bool exclusive) in msm_gem_sync_object()
|